Output 703771903b62c1f4c95295ab524727fc7f3654da34beb68d90c93e85c2bdf54a:101

value
8134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ef3ea87a35955fd863fc44cf88395187c538425a OP_EQUAL
address
3PW2UxFMrQqPzCzr5ybTaDDWvkQwdrXU41
transaction
703771903b62c1f4c95295ab524727fc7f3654da34beb68d90c93e85c2bdf54a